Xray Racing Series Italy finale – Report

The final round of the Xray Racing Series Italy was held at the Gianni Modellismo track in Rome. Classes run were Touring Modified, Touring Pro Stock, Touring Stock and Formula. In the Touring Modified class it was Alessio Menicucci who set the pace in the hot and low traction conditions in front of Simone D’Ottavio and Nicola Marrone. In the finals Alessio confirmed his qualifying performance by laying down mistake-free runs to take the overall win from Simone and Nicola who both fought for the overall runner-up spot but it was Simone who prevailed to take the 2nd spot on the podium.

In the Touring Pro Stock class Alessio Valentini took the TQ from Flavio Buzi, Valter Cola and Nico Catelani. The latter three drivers were very close, separated by less than 0.05 seconds. Valentini confirmed his pace in the finals as he took the overall win from Valter Cola who was able to take the 2nd place in front of Flavio Buzi after a tight fight.

The Touring Stock class saw the attendance of a lot of young drivers but ultimately it was Alessandro Bagagli who made better use of the used tyres in the finals to keep pole sitter Flavio Anelli behind in 2nd place. Marco D’Onofrio would round out the top 3 results.

With the Rome track being home for many F1TA series drivers the Formula class was hotly contested. Fabio Domanin took the pole position for the finals with Magnocavallo in 2nd place and Giorgio Alberto in 3rd. In the finals a tyre damage made Domanin slow down with Magnocavallo winning the race followed by Cardelli and Maciocchi.
